  2. Oct 30, 2020 · The 6th Air Refueling Wing traces its roots indirectly back toe ear th ly years of American military aviation when its predecessor was organized in 1919. Initially named the 3rd Observation Group, the unit was redesignated as the 6th Composite Group in 1922 and assigned to France Field, Panama Canal Zone.

  6. Both non-tanker aircraft types were later replaced by the C-37. On 1 January 2001 the 6th ARW reorganized again and became the 6th Air Mobility Wing (6 AMW), assigned to Air Mobility Command 's Eighteenth Air Force . The 6 AMW has twice won the Air Mobility Rodeo Best Air Mobility Wing Award; in 2000 and 2005.

  8. On October 1, 2019, the 6th Air Mobility Wing deactivated the 310th Airlift Squadron, and removed three C-37A's from its inventory. The wing was redesignated as the 6th Air Refueling Wing.
